Question
Write balanced equation for the reaction of dilute sulphuric acid with the following:
Zinc hydroxide
Advertisements
Solution
Balanced equation is : Zinc hydroxide
Zn(OH)2 + H2SO4 → ZnSO4 + 2H2O
